Objectives<br />
Biological Objectives<br />
All the following objectives are exclusive of events beyond the control of the<br />
site managers<br />
Objective 1.<br />
To maintain the dwarf shrub habitats in favourable condition with<br />
particular reference to H2 Calluna vulgaris –Ulex minor and H3 Ulex<br />
minor – Agrostis curtisii European dry heath and M16 Erica tetralix –<br />
Sphagnum compactum North Atlantic wet heath, and their associated<br />
species<br />
Features addressed by this objective<br />
1 to 16<br />
Attributes for key features<br />
Feature 1: H1/H2 European dry heath<br />
Feature 2: H3 European dry heath<br />
Attribute: Extent<br />
Target: No un-consented decline in the area of habitat – (see Map 7)<br />
Attribute: Bare ground<br />
Target: 5-10% firm bare ground including compacted paths, flat areas, slopes,<br />
banks and faces<br />
Attribute: Vegetation composition – bryophytes and lichens<br />
Target: Cover maintained where naturally present – Cladonia strepsilis, C.<br />
arbuscula present.<br />
Attribute: Vegetation composition - trees and scrub<br />
Target: < 15% of sufficient age, species and structural diversity to<br />
support invertebrate and breeding bird assemblages<br />
Attribute: Vegetation composition – dwarf shrubs<br />
Target: At least two of following species present – Calluna vulgaris, Erica<br />
cinerea, E. tetralix, Genista anglica, Ulex minor<br />
Attribute: Vegetation structure – dwarf shrub cover<br />
Target: 25-75 % cover of dwarf shrubs<br />
Attribute: Vegetation structure Ulex spp.<br />
Target: < 50% Ulex/Genista spp. cover, >5% < 25% Ulex europaeus cover, no<br />
large blocks of U. europeaus<br />
